The minister of justice and attorney general of the federation, Abubakar Malami says federal government is using recovered loot to fund 2020 budget, fight corruption and insecurity.
Malami who was represented by the special adviser to the president on justice reform, Juliet ibekaku-Nwagu at the tenth conference on the implication of insecurity and corruption by the centre for peace and environmental justice, said the closure of land border is also helping to curb criminality
